Backflow testing services involve inspecting and evaluating the backflow prevention devices installed within plumbing systems. These devices are designed to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ply, ensuring that drinking water remains safe and uncontaminated. During testing, professionals examine the functionality of backflow preventers, checking for proper operation and identifying any potential issues that could compromise water quality. Regular testing helps maintain the integrity of the plumbing system and ensures compliance with local health and safety regulations.

One of the primary issues backflow testing addresses is the risk of backflow contamination, which can occur due to pressure changes, pipe damage, or improper device installation. If backflow preventers fail or are not functioning correctly, pollutants from irrigation systems, industrial processes, or even household wastewater can enter the potable water supply. Detecting these problems early through routine testing allows property owners to prevent health hazards and avoid costly repairs or water service interruptions caused by contaminated water.

Properties that typically utilize backflow testing services include residential homes, commercial buildings, and industrial facilities. Homes with irrigation systems, swimming pools, or well water sources often require regular testing to ensure that their backflow preventers are working correctly. Commercial and industrial properties, especially those involved in manufacturing or food processing, also rely on backflow testing to comply with safety standards and protect public health. Additionally, property managers and local institutions may schedule routine testing as part of their ongoing maintenance and safety protocols.

Cost Range - Backflow testing services typically cost between $75 and $200 per test, depending on the size and complexity of the system. For example, a basic residential backflow device may be tested for around $75, while larger commercial systems could be closer to $200.

Pricing Factors - The overall cost can vary based on the number of devices needing testing and the accessibility of the installation. Additional fees may apply if repairs or adjustments are necessary after testing, which can add $50 to $150 to the total.

Service Variations - Some local service providers include testing in a package that also offers inspection or maintenance, with prices starting at approximately $100. Standalone testing services generally fall within the $75 to $200 range.

Cost Considerations - Costs may fluctuate depending on the region and the service provider’s pricing policies. It’s common for prices to differ by about $25 to $50 between providers in Powell, OH, and nearby are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is backflow testing? Backflow testing involves inspecting a plumbing system to ensure that contaminated water cannot flow back into the clean water supply, helping to prevent potential health hazards.

How often should backflow testing be performed? Typically, backflow testing is recommended annually to maintain compliance and ensure the system's proper functioning.

Who provides backflow testing services? Local plumbing or backflow specialists offer backflow testing services to residential and commercial properties.

What are the signs that I need backflow testing? If you notice unusual water pressure, discoloration, or odors in your water supply, it may indicate a need for backflow testing; a professional can evaluate your system.
